What is Double Glazing?
nearby double glazing glazing includes two separate panes of glass that are sealed together with an airtight space between them. Usually, this space is filled with an inert gas, typically argon or krypton, which improves insulation by lowering heat transfer.
Key Components of Double Glazing
Panes of Glass: Usually made from tempered or laminated glass, these panels are developed to hold up against different ecological conditions.

Spacer Bar: Placed in between the 2 panes, this product preserves the area and supports them, typically made from products like aluminum or composite products.

Sealing: The edges of the glass panes are sealed with a durable sealant to avoid wetness and contaminants from getting in the area between the panes.

Inert Gas: The area between the panes is typically filled with argon, krypton, or xenon gas, which provides better insulation compared to air.

Comprehending the various types of double glazing can help property owners select the very best option for their requirements.
1. Basic Double GlazingDescription: This is the most common type, featuring two panes of glass that provide a fundamental level of insulation.2. Low-E (Low Emissivity) GlassDescription: This glass has a special finishing that reflects heat back inside, enhancing energy effectiveness.3. Acoustic Double GlazingDescription: Designed for noise reduction, this type utilizes thicker or laminated glass to reduce sound transmission.4.
